The only "UFO" I have ever seen was about six years ago. I was driving home late from work and there was a light moving in the sky about a half a mile in front of me and only about 150 feet off the ground. The light was moving along a cross road that I was approaching. At the corner of these two roads is a vets office. There, it stopped and hovered for a few seconds and a light shined down in a spotlight fashion. I kid you not it lit up a large portion of the yard and building and I could see it from where I was as it was a very dark night and they don't have any bright security lights like that on normally. After about 5-10 seconds the light stopped shining and the UFO moved away. It is all woods in that area with no street lighting so I couldn't get a look at the UFO's profile so it very well could have been just a helicopter with a spotlight. When the light appeared dim to me could have just been when I could only see a small portion of the light and it wasn't pointed at a target I could see and then only appeared bright when I could see the target, but it was fairly freaky since I couldn't hear a helicopter at all when I stopped and turned the radio off.

I have definitely seen a "UFO", but I believe it was some sort of top secret military test craft. I go often to upstate New York to hang out with friends in a cabin etc. This particular time was within a hundred miles or so of an airbase. We were hanging out by the fire being extremely loud etc paying no mind, but for some reason i decided to look up and behind my shoulder. And flying VERY VERY low to the ground, maybe 15 feet above the pine trees, was a Triangular object flying at very slow speed and in complete silence. It had three lights on its bottom at the points of the triangle. This thing was so silent that no one else noticed it
It WAS headed towards the airbase.....It was too large to be UAV and traveling far to slowly to be any sort of full scale plane with what we currently know we use as propulsion systems. I highly doubt it was of extraterrestrial origin.
**EDIT** The treeline was approximately 50 feet behind us so this thing was EXTREMELY close to us and yet completely silent. I would recon they saw the campfire and were testing whether we would notice them....
